Crawlspace Foundation Repair in Hartford, CT
Crawlspace fo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ation beneath the home. These services typically cover projects such as stabilizing sagging or bowed joists, repairing or replacing damaged beams, and addressing moisture problems that can cause wood rot or mold growth. Homeowners often seek this type of repair when noticing symptoms like uneven flooring, cracks in interior walls, or musty odors coming from the crawlspace, aiming to prevent further structural damage and improve indoor air quality.
Before requesting crawlspace fo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es behind foundation issues, and the options available for repair or stabilization. It’s important to consider factors such as the age of the home, soil conditions, and any previous repairs. Clear communication about the scope of work, potential costs, and the expected outcomes can help hom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ining the safety and stability of their property.

Common Crawlspace Foundation Repair Jobs
Crawlspace foundation repair involves fixing issues that compromise the stability and safety of a home’s foundation.
Moisture control helps prevent mold growth and wood rot in the crawlspace area.
Sagging or uneven floors can be addressed through structural reinforcement of the crawlspace supports.
Vapor barrier installation reduces humidity and protects against water damage beneath the home.
Pier and beam stabilization restores support to prevent settlement and shifting of the foundation.
Pest prevention solutions eliminate conditions that attract termites and other pests into the crawlspace.
Crawlspace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ls, and musty odors in the home.
Why is it important to repair a damaged crawlspace foundation? Repairing helps prevent further structural damage and improves indoor air quality.
What types of repair options are available for crawlspace foundations? Common solutions include pier and beam stabilization, underpinning, and sealing or encapsulation.
How can property owners prevent future crawlspace problems? Regular inspections, proper ventilation, and moisture control can help maintain a healthy foundation.
